How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hardyville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hardyville Studio Apartments | $883 | $685 | $999 |
| Hardyville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,118 | $645 | $2,650 |
| Hardyville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,336 | $745 | $1,940 |
| Hardyville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,653 | $950 | $2,500 |
| Hardyville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,999 | $2,999 | $2,999 |

Cheapest Pet Friendly Apartment Rentals in Hardyville , KY and nearby
The lowest priced Hardyville apartment at a property that allows pets is the The Julep 1 Bed Model at Mount Victor Olde Towne Luxury Apartments in the Downtown Bowling Green neighborhood starting from $989. The second cheapest Hardyville Pet Friendly apartment is the The Caddie Model at Fairways at Hartland, which is a 2 Beds starting at $1,012 in the Downtown Bowling Green neighborhood. Here are the most affordable Pet Friendly Hardyville apartments.
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| Mount Victor Olde Towne Luxury Apartments | The Julep | $989 |
| Fairways at Hartland | The Caddie | $1,012 |
| Royal Arms of Bowling Green | 2x2 | $1,050 |
| Claysville Landing Apartment Suites | 2x2 | $1,100 |
| Covington Oaks | The Willow w/attached Garage | $1,139 |
| The Joule | 1 bedroom/1 bath, center unit | $1,150 |
| The Reserve at Cool Springs | ZENITH | $1,199 |
| Waterford Place Apartments | 2BR/2BA Unfurnished | $1,200 |
| Buffalo Ridge Townhomes | Osage No Garage | $1,399 |
| Sage Springs | 2 Bed, 2 Bath | $1,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Hardyville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Hardyville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Hardyville is $1,000.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Hardyville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Hardyville is a 1,200 square feet unit starting from $800 at Royal Arms of Bowling Green.
What is the average size for Hardyville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Hardyville is currently at 750 sq ft.
